Output f325668e5cefbba9c3ebba73c0f596e1fe2bf61d90f5f956eb4176c3e77859d1:0

value
751365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8deb6b1ba417fccbedee7716e90a25848bf5502 OP_EQUAL
address
3NvKVTsLh6fTZmFt1DfotdQbYfqgxu7PwC
transaction
f325668e5cefbba9c3ebba73c0f596e1fe2bf61d90f5f956eb4176c3e77859d1
confirmations
303332
spent
true